Ratio of 4:5:6 blue red and yellow balloon 120 balloon how many of each xolour

lets say a balloon = x

4x + 5x + 6x = 120
15x = 120                   (divide each side by 15)
15x/15 = 120/15
x = 8

blue balloons = 4x = 4(8) = 32
red balloons = 5x = 5(8) = 40
yellow balloons = 6x = 6(8) = 48
